S.B. 1112

Patron: Locke

Research and development tax credits. Provides that the research and development expenses tax credit and the major research and development expenses tax credit shall be available against the bank franchise tax for taxable years beginning on and after January 1, 2021. Under current law, the credits are available only against the individual and corporate income tax.

A BILL to amend and reenact §§ 58.1-439.12:08 and 58.1-439.12:11 of the Code of Virginia, relating to research and development tax credits.

S.B. 1158

Patron: Spruill

Port of Virginia tax credits; sunset. Extends the sunset for the international trade facility tax credit, the barge and rail usage tax credit, and the port volume increase tax credit from taxable years before January 1, 2022, to taxable years before January 1, 2025.

A BILL to amend and reenact §§ 58.1-439.12:06, 58.1-439.12:09, and 58.1-439.12:10 of the Code of Virginia, relating to Port of Virginia tax credits; sunset.

S.B. 1170

Patron: Norment

Additional local sales and use tax to support schools. Adds Isle of Wight County to the list of localities that, under current law, are authorized to impose an additional local sales and use tax at a rate not to exceed one percent, with the revenue used only for capital projects for the construction or renovation of schools.

A BILL to amend and reenact §§ 58.1-602 and 58.1-605 of the Code of Virginia, relating to additional local sales and use tax to support schools.
